It wasn’t until I was about 17 before I decided to try and destroy my acne (by then most of the emotional damage had been done – oh well). After trying some over the counter treatments, I went for the big one, and got a prescription of Tetrocycline (which didn’t quite work for me), and then switched to Accutane. It worked, but wasn’t a very pleasant experience. I will always suggest you first try something a bit simpler and safer, prior to going to the doctor. If those don’t work, then work your way up the acne treatment ladder. Why, you ask? Those particular prescription medications came with some disturbing side effects, such as “peeling lips” (where you literally peeled layers of skin off your lips – and left them raw, only to have to do it again later, or risk walking around with shredded lips. I know, disgusting). Or other issues like severe sun-sensitivity. And if you’re pregnant, forget ‘bout it.
